One of Shasta County’s hardest hit industries is on a slow road to recovery. Some job gains were seen in July for leisure and hospitality workers. The overall unemployment rate was unchanged between June and July, remaining at 7%. It’s still a significant improvement from last July’s 10.1%, when there were 2,000 fewer people in the labor force. The unadjusted California rate was 7.9% last month, and it was 5.7% nationwide.
